Human settlements: Thieving ANC blames apartheid for its own shortcomings

The only thing that the ANC government in the Free State and its Department of Human Settlements have succeeded in is not providing the people of the Free State with proper housing and sanitation.

After 26 years of a so-called free democracy, the government and its Department are still maintaining that Apartheid is to blame for the current housing problems in the province. The reality, however, is that after being in power for 26 long years, many people in the Free State still do not have access to proper housing, water and sanitation.

The various housing scandals of the past ten years, in which various high-ranking ANC officials have been implicated, have made it abundantly clear that the ANC government is only focused on what it can take for itself instead of what it can offer the people of the Free State. No budget will serve as a cure for the ruling party’s greed, maladministration and incompetence.

Simply blaming the past and Apartheid will not provide the poor with houses.

As long as this Department keeps blaming the past for its own shortcomings, misguided priorities and maladministration, the people of the Free State will continue to suffer. And that will be the bitter heritage of this provincial government.
